WebUsually this is caused by a combination of infection and blockage of the tear ducts. The tear ducts are little tiny tubes that go from the eye to the nose, (humans have them too, it's why your nose runs when you cry). Waterfowl that have this often have a pseudomonas or aspergillus infection in the tear duct. WebInfection with the bacteria Riemerella anatipestifer is also known as new duck disease. This duck has a condition known in lay terms as foamy eye or bubble eye. It is generally not indicative of an eye disease but rather an upper respiratory one, and affected ducks sometimes sneeze as well. Occasionally, this discharge can indicate a blocked tear duct.

WebConjunctivitis is the irritation and inflammation of the conjunctiva (the membrane of the inner eyelid and the inner corner of the eye's surface). It can occur unilaterally (in one eye) or bilaterally (in both eyes) in ducks.
